Transaction 872fdda3dc6ae23f29d5c64c0ab4a5319c3136db3e682601987d16c1deb74126
1 Input
1 Output
-
872fdda3dc6ae23f29d5c64c0ab4a5319c3136db3e682601987d16c1deb74126:0
- value
- 12229696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9eecfe46d24ebbacfd0b9c2aa630588b748f67d OP_EQUAL
- address
- 3Je91zAyvMrLZf2GDT7puGi6CCkLFp8gH1